Exotic plant invasion and its ecological risk assessment

Abstract: Exotic plant invasion is an urgent global issue that threatens the sustainable development of ecosystem health. Its prevention is more effectual than treatment, and thus, the study of its ecological risk assessment could help us to prevent and reduce the invasion risk more effectively. Based on the theory of ecological risk assessment, and through the analyses of the characteristics and processes of exotic plant invasion, this paper discussed the methodologies of the ecological risk assessment of exotic plant invasion. The assessment procedure was consisted of risk source analysis, receptor analysis, exposure and hazard assessment, integral assessment, and working out of management measures. The indicator system of risk source assessment as well as the indices and formulas applied to measure the ecological loss and risk were established, and the method for comprehensively assessing the ecological risk of exotic plant invasion was worked out.
